21 # --config add the given configuration file, which will be read after
22 # any "Configurations*" files that are found in the same
23 # directory as this script.
24 # --openssldir install OpenSSL in OPENSSLDIR (Default: DIR/ssl if the
25 # --prefix option is given; /usr/local/ssl otherwise)
26 # --prefix prefix for the OpenSSL include, lib and bin directories
27 # (Default: the OPENSSLDIR directory)
29 # --install_prefix Additional prefix for package builders (empty by
30 # default). This needn't be set in advance, you can
31 # just as well use "make INSTALL_PREFIX=/whatever install".
33 # --test-sanity Make a number of sanity checks on the data in this file.
34 # This is a debugging tool for OpenSSL developers.
36 # --cross-compile-prefix Add specified prefix to binutils components.
38 # --api One of 0.9.8, 1.0.0 or 1.1.0. Do not compile support for
39 # interfaces deprecated as of the specified OpenSSL version.
41 # no-hw-xxx do not compile support for specific crypto hardware.
42 # Generic OpenSSL-style methods relating to this support
43 # are always compiled but return NULL if the hardware
44 # support isn't compiled.
45 # no-hw do not compile support for any crypto hardware.
46 # [no-]threads [don't] try to create a library that is suitable for
47 # multithreaded applications (default is "threads" if we
49 # [no-]shared [don't] try to create shared libraries when supported.
50 # no-asm do not use assembler
51 # no-dso do not compile in any native shared-library methods. This
52 # will ensure that all methods just return NULL.
53 # no-egd do not compile support for the entropy-gathering daemon APIs
54 # [no-]zlib [don't] compile support for zlib compression.
55 # zlib-dynamic Like "zlib", but the zlib library is expected to be a shared
56 # library and will be loaded in run-time by the OpenSSL library.
57 # sctp include SCTP support
58 # 386 generate 80386 code
59 # no-sse2 disables IA-32 SSE2 code, above option implies no-sse2
60 # no-<cipher> build without specified algorithm (rsa, idea, rc5, ...)
61 # -<xxx> +<xxx> compiler options are passed through
63 # DEBUG_SAFESTACK use type-safe stacks to enforce type-safety on stack items
64 # provided to stack calls. Generates unique stack functions for
65 # each possible stack type.
66 # DES_PTR use pointer lookup vs arrays in the DES in crypto/des/des_locl.h
67 # DES_RISC1 use different DES_ENCRYPT macro that helps reduce register
68 # dependancies but needs to more registers, good for RISC CPU's
69 # DES_RISC2 A different RISC variant.
70 # DES_UNROLL unroll the inner DES loop, sometimes helps, somtimes hinders.
71 # DES_INT use 'int' instead of 'long' for DES_LONG in crypto/des/des.h
72 # This is used on the DEC Alpha where long is 8 bytes
74 # BN_LLONG use the type 'long long' in crypto/bn/bn.h
75 # MD2_CHAR use 'char' instead of 'int' for MD2_INT in crypto/md2/md2.h
76 # MD2_LONG use 'long' instead of 'int' for MD2_INT in crypto/md2/md2.h
77 # IDEA_SHORT use 'short' instead of 'int' for IDEA_INT in crypto/idea/idea.h
78 # IDEA_LONG use 'long' instead of 'int' for IDEA_INT in crypto/idea/idea.h
79 # RC2_SHORT use 'short' instead of 'int' for RC2_INT in crypto/rc2/rc2.h
80 # RC2_LONG use 'long' instead of 'int' for RC2_INT in crypto/rc2/rc2.h
81 # RC4_CHAR use 'char' instead of 'int' for RC4_INT in crypto/rc4/rc4.h
82 # RC4_LONG use 'long' instead of 'int' for RC4_INT in crypto/rc4/rc4.h
83 # RC4_INDEX define RC4_INDEX in crypto/rc4/rc4_locl.h. This turns on
84 # array lookups instead of pointer use.
85 # RC4_CHUNK enables code that handles data aligned at long (natural CPU
87 # RC4_CHUNK_LL enables code that handles data aligned at long long boundary
88 # (intended for 64-bit CPUs running 32-bit OS).
89 # BF_PTR use 'pointer arithmatic' for Blowfish (unsafe on Alpha).
90 # BF_PTR2 intel specific version (generic version is more efficient).

1400 # Unlike other OSes (like Solaris, Linux, Tru64, IRIX) BSD run-time
1401 # linkers (tested OpenBSD, NetBSD and FreeBSD) "demand" RPATH set on
1402 # .so objects. Apparently application RPATH is not global and does
1403 # not apply to .so linked with other .so. Problem manifests itself
1404 # when libssl.so fails to load libcrypto.so. One can argue that we
1405 # should engrave this into Makefile.shared rules or into BSD-* config
1406 # lines above. Meanwhile let's try to be cautious and pass -rpath to
1407 # linker only when --prefix is not /usr.
1408 if ($target =~ /^BSD\-/)
1410 $shared_ldflag.=" -Wl,-rpath,\$\$(LIBRPATH)" if ($prefix !~ m|^/usr[/]*$|);
